Liverpool fans were pleasantly surprised by Ryan Gravenberch’s outstanding performance in their 4-1 pre-season victory over Sevilla, as the Dutch midfielder showcased his potential in a new role under manager Arne Slot. The match, Slot’s first at Anfield since taking charge, saw Gravenberch excel in a defensive midfield role, impressing fans with his ball-playing abilities and overall contribution to the game.

 

Liverpool fielded a strong lineup featuring stars like Virgil van Dijk, Trent Alexander-Arnold, and Mohamed Salah, but it was Gravenberch who caught the eye. Fans took to social media, particularly X (formerly Twitter), to express their admiration for his display. One fan highlighted his performance by saying, “Gravenberch really impressing in the 6 yet again 👏🏼👏🏼👏🏼,” while another commented on how well he has adapted to Slot’s system, stating, “Ryan Gravenberch has fit into this Arne Slot team like a glove, finally able to showcase his strength and ball-playing ability!”

 

Gravenberch, who joined Liverpool last summer, had struggled to secure a regular starting spot under former manager Jurgen Klopp. However, with Slot’s new tactical approach, the 22-year-old appears to be flourishing. His stats from the Sevilla match were particularly impressive: he completed 53 out of 56 passes, boasting a 95% success rate, won 60% of his ground duels, and created a significant goal-scoring opportunity. These contributions were pivotal to Liverpool’s dominant victory, which also saw goals from Diogo Jota, Trey Nyoni, and a brace from Luis Diaz.

Despite his excellent performance, there is speculation that Gravenberch’s starting position could be threatened if Liverpool succeeds in signing Real Sociedad’s Martin Zubimendi, a top transfer target for the club. However, with Wataru Endo seemingly out of favor, Gravenberch could still expect significant game time this season.

 

Liverpool will continue their pre-season preparations with another friendly against Las Palmas later today, where Gravenberch and others will have another opportunity to impress ahead of the new Premier League campaign.
